Everything is circadian

This result was finally published. TL;DR: Treating cancer early in the morning seems to substantially beat treating it later in the day. Just changing patient appointment times is supposedly associated with a ~60% reduction in cancer mortality.

“Mean EAA digestibility” is a poor marker for protein quality. You need to look at leucine/lysine/methionine per kcal, and that’s where animal foods shine. Far greater density of the amino acids that truly matter than even your soy burger (which, agreed, is decent)
